Philippa Aylott
Philippa is a highly experienced broadcast senior leader, having worked extensively across both audio production, commissioning and live events.
Raised in Stroud, Gloucestershire and further educated in Sheffield. With a stint working in A&R, she was then lured by the golden lights of London with the promise of working in radio.
Philippa is now the Senior Commissioning Executive at BBC Music, working across the editorial and strategy of the BBC Music portfolio which houses the BBC’s music radio networks, Pop TV, Live Music and Events, Music On Demand and BBC Introducing.
Previous roles include Head of Production for BBC Radio 2 and 6 Music, Editor for both BBC Radio 2 and BBC 6 Music, editorial lead for Glastonbury, event producer for the BBC’s Electric Proms, producer of the BBC’s Sound Of..poll and a producer at BBC Radio 1. Philippa has previously been on the board of Trustees at the Academy before joining the deputy chair role and is an advocate for a thriving audio ecosystem.
